Venus and Serena Williams to become Part-Owners of the Miami Dolphins

Venus and Serena Williams are trailblazers in the world of tennis. Now these two sisters are charting a new course -- part owners of the Miami Dolphins. According to media reports, the agreement is being finalized and I hope it will come to fruition. The two women live in Palm Beach Gardens, Fla., and this development would be significant because the NFL has no African-American majority team owner.
Musicians Gloria and Emilio Estefan and Marc Anthony recently bought small shares of the team. New Dolphins owner Stephen Ross also forged a partnership with singer Jimmy Buffett. The Dolphins have said the involvement of the celebrities reflects the diversity of South Florida and shows that the franchise is connected with the community.

"There's always so many opportunities out there, and Venus and I are always trying to expand our brand and do the best that we can do, and if an opportunity presents itself, we would love to see where it can take us," Serena Williams said. "Who knows what's going to happen, but hopefully we'll be able to hopefully continue to expand our brand." Source: Google News
The sisters have combined to win 18 Grand Slam titles, and they staged their latest sibling match last month at Wimbledon, where Serena beat Venus in the final. Serena Williams has won 11 major titles and big sister Venus has won seven.
